How Can Tourists Access Entalula Island from El Nido?

Tourists can access Entalula Island from El Nido primarily by boat, which is the most common and convenient method.

The process of reaching Entalula Island involves several key steps:

  1. Boat Rentals: Tourists can rent boats from El Nido to travel to Entalula Island. Numerous local boat operators offer various choices ranging from small banca boats to larger tourist vessels. Rental prices typically range from 1,500 to 3,500 Philippine pesos, depending on the size and capacity of the boat.

  2. Group Tours: Tourists can join organized group tours that include Entalula Island in their itinerary. These tours often cover multiple destinations in one trip, maximizing sightseeing opportunities. Group tour prices usually range from 1,200 to 1,500 pesos per person and include lunch and snorkeling gear.

  3. Private Charters: For a more personalized experience, tourists may opt for private charters. This option allows for flexibility in travel time and itinerary. Private charter costs can range from 3,500 pesos to over 10,000 pesos, depending on the boat type and duration of the rental.

  4. Travel Time: The journey from El Nido to Entalula Island takes approximately 30 minutes to 1 hour, depending on the boat speed and sea conditions. Travelers often enjoy scenic views of the surrounding islands and limestone cliffs during the ride.

  5. Weather Considerations: Tourists should check local weather conditions before embarking on the trip. The best time to visit is typically during the dry season, from November to May, when sea conditions are calmer.

  6. Safety Gear: All boats are required to carry safety equipment, including life vests. Tourists should ensure that the boat operator adheres to safety regulations for a secure journey.

When Is the Best Time to Visit Entalula Island?

The best time to visit Entalula Island is between November and May. During these months, the weather is dry and sunny. Visitors can enjoy clear skies and warm temperatures. The peak tourist season occurs from December to February, offering vibrant local activities. However, visiting outside this peak time can provide a quieter experience. Overall, November to May ensures optimal conditions for exploring the island’s natural beauty.

What Environmental Conservation Efforts Are in Place on Entalula Island?

Entalula Island, located in El Nido, Philippines, implements various environmental conservation efforts aimed at preserving its natural beauty and ecological balance.

  1. Protected Area Status
  2. Waste Management Programs
  3. Coral Reef Restoration Projects
  4. Biodiversity Monitoring
  5. Sustainable Tourism Practices

These efforts highlight different perspectives in conservation approaches, balancing environmental protection with community needs and tourism development. They aim to maintain the island’s ecological integrity while providing income for local communities.

  1. Protected Area Status: Entalula Island is designated as part of the El Nido-Taytay Managed Resource Protected Area. This status helps safeguard its ecosystems from overexploitation. The government and local organizations enforce regulations to protect wildlife and habitats from harmful activities.

The Department of Environment and Natural Resources (DENR) supports this initiative by implementing restrictions on fishing and development. The protected area attracts ecological tourists, which can bolster the local economy.
